Though histories of early America acknowledge this today, that has not always been the case, and even today much work needs to be done to appreciate more fully the nature of the interactions between the settlers and the “First Peoples” and to hear the impressions of, and exchanges between, these two groups. We also have much to learn about Native Americans as people—their cultures, their languages, their views of the world, and their religious beliefs—and about their impressions of the early settlers.   One avenue to recovering the history of these relations examines early records that sought to understand the First Peoples scientifically. Missionaries were among those who chronicled the exchange between early settlers and Native Americans. The diaries, letters, and journals of these early ethnographers are among the most valuable resources for recovering the languages, religions, cultures, and political makeup of the First Peoples. This volume explores the interactions of two seventeenth- and eighteenth-century European settlement peoples with Native Americans: German-speaking Moravian Protestants and French-speaking Roman Catholics. These two European groups have provided some of the richest records of the exchange between early settlers and Native Americans.  Editor A. G. Yet German immigrants to the colonies also contributed to - and developed for themselves - an American political consciousness. In this book, A.G. Roeber focuses on this neglected subject and explains why so many Germans - when they faced critical choices in 1776 - became active supporters of the patriot cause. Employing a variety of German-language sources, Roeber explores German conceptions of personal and public property in the context of cultural and religious beliefs, village life and family concerns. He follows all the major German migration streams, beginning with the Palatines in New York and including Germans who settled in Pennsylvania, Virginia, South Carolina and Georgia. Roeber's study of German-American ideas about liberty and property provides a unique and new perspective within a growing historiography on the transfer of culture and beliefs from Europe and Africa to America.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 -","offer_id":50884130701585,"sku":"","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"US \/ VERY_GOOD \/ SBYB","offer_id":50884131094801,"sku":"CIN0801844592VG","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/0801844592.jpg?v=1750849443"},{"product_id":"remembering-reputation-and-prosperity-book-a-g-roeber-9780932624284","title":"Remembering Reputation and Prosperity","description":null,"br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 -","offer_id":51009612054801,"sku":"","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":51009615200529,"sku":"NIN9780932624284","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/0932624286.jpg?v=1751298894"},{"product_id":"orthodox-christians-and-the-rights-revolution-in-america-book-a-g-roeber-9781531505042","title":"Orthodox Christians and the Rights Revolution in America","description":"A distinctive and unrivaled examination of North American Eastern Orthodox Christians and their encounter with the rights revolution in a pluralistic American society.  From the civil rights movement of the 1950s to the \"culture wars\" of North America, commentators have identified the partisans bent on pursuing different \"rights\" claims. When religious identity surfaces as a key determinant in how the pursuit of rights occurs, both \"the religious right\" and \"liberal\" believers remain the focus of how each contributes to making rights demands. How Orthodox Christians in North America have navigated the \"rights revolution,\" however, remains largely unknown. From the disagreements over the rights of the First Peoples of Alaska to arguments about the rights of transgender persons, Orthodox Christians have engaged an anglo-American legal and constitutional rights tradition. But they see rights claims through the lens of an inherited focus on the dignity of the human person.  In a pluralistic society and culture, Orthodox Christians, both converts and those with family roots in Orthodox countries, share with non-Orthodox fellow citizens the challenge of reconciling conflicting rights claims. Those claims do pit \"religious liberty\" rights claims against perceived dangers from outside the Orthodox Church. But internal disagreements about the rights of clergy and people within the Church accompany the Orthodox Christian engagement with debates over gender, sex, and marriage as well as expanding political, legal, and human rights claims. Despite their small numbers, North American Orthodox remain highly visible and their struggles influential among the more than 280 million Orthodox worldwide. Orthodox Christians and the Rights Revolution in America offers an historical analysis of this unfolding story.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 -","offer_id":51034154565905,"sku":"","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":51034156925201,"sku":"NIN9781531505042","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/153150504X.jpg?v=1750990565"},{"product_id":"orthodox-christians-and-the-rights-revolution-in-america-book-a-g-roeber-9781531505035","title":"Orthodox Christians and the Rights Revolution in America","description":"A distinctive and unrivaled examination of North American Eastern Orthodox Christians and their encounter with the rights revolution in a pluralistic American society.
